According to Stratistics MRC, the Global Assortment and Space Optimization Market is accounted for $2.36 billion in 2025 and is expected to reach $5.35 billion by 2032 growing at a CAGR of 12.42% during the forecast period. The strategic process of choosing the ideal product mix (assortment) and effectively arranging them in the available retail space (space optimisation) in order to optimise sales and customer happiness is known as "assortment and space optimisation." To decide which products to offer, in what number, and where to put them in-store or online, it entails examining customer demand, product performance, and available space. In the end, this strategy increases profitability and operational efficiency across a range of retail formats by assisting retailers in improving inventory turnover, decreasing stockouts, and improving the shopping experience.
Rising demand for data-driven retail planning
Advanced analytics are being used by retailers more and more to comprehend the preferences and behaviour of their customers. This makes it possible to create a precise product assortment that is suited to the target market, increasing customer happiness and sales. Allocating space optimally lowers inventory costs and increases shelf efficiency. Retailers may also swiftly adjust to seasonal shifts and market trends with the use of data-driven insights. All things considered, this strategy improves competitive advantage and operational efficiency in the retail industry.
High implementation cost and integration complexity
A financial barrier is created by the significant expenditure needed for technology, software, and qualified staff. Since these solutions must integrate seamlessly with the current IT infrastructure, integration complexity adds still another level of difficulty. Longer deployment durations and a greater likelihood of operational disruptions can result from this complexity. Businesses may have difficulties with personnel training, system compatibility, and data migration. These elements work together to limit acceptance and lower consumer willingness to invest, which impedes broad market expansion.

Data privacy concerns and regulatory pressures
Adoption of technology is slowed by the increased operational complexity and expenses associated with complying with regulations such as the CCPA and GDPR. The breadth and depth of data analytics are constrained by these legal constraints, which lowers the precision of optimisation solutions. Project execution may be delayed because organisations frequently struggle to secure client consent and maintain data security. Furthermore, some participants are deterred from utilising sophisticated data-driven technologies to their full potential due to concerns about sanctions and reputational harm. In general, privacy laws erect obstacles that impede this industry's ability to innovate and thrive.
Covid-19 Impact
The Covid-19 pandemic significantly impacted the Assortment and Space Optimization Market by disrupting global retail operations, supply chains, and consumer behavior. Retailers faced challenges in inventory management and adapting product assortments to sudden shifts in demand. Store closures and reduced foot traffic accelerated the need for data-driven space optimization tools. As e-commerce surged, businesses adopted advanced analytics and AI-driven solutions to improve shelf planning and assortment strategies, ensuring operational efficiency and customer satisfaction in a rapidly changing retail environment.

In March 2025, Oracle was recognized as a Leader in the 2025 IDC MarketScape for AI-driven Retail Assortment Planning Solutions. The report highlighted Oracle's AI-powered advanced SKU prioritization and assortment optimization capabilities, noting active results in cost savings and strong partnerships in developing new assortment optimization methods.
In June 2024, SAP acquired WalkMe, a digital adoption platform, for $1.5 billion. This acquisition aims to enhance user experience and adoption of SAP solutions, including those related to assortment and space optimization.
In March 2023, SAP partnered with Axfood, Sweden's second-largest food retailer, to develop an advanced assortment planning solution. This collaboration aimed to create a user-friendly system that integrates data from sales histories, forecasts, and customer insights, enhancing decision-making processes and reducing product wastage.
